Ranging from a community of 3 platforms with twelve,000 citizens and guests, it's the prospective to extend to more than twenty platforms. The floating platforms are accompanied by dozens of productive outposts with photovoltaic panels and greenhouses which can grow and agreement as time passes according to the requires of Busan. OCEANIX Busan has six integrated devices: zero squander and round methods, shut loop water systems, food items, Web zero Strength, progressive mobility, and coastal habitat regeneration. These interconnected methods will deliver 100% of the demanded operational energy on website by floating and rooftop photovoltaic panels. Similarly, Every single neighborhood will deal with and replenish its own drinking water, reduce and recycle assets, and provide progressive city agriculture.
